There use to be a web site called Applekeynotes.com which had (with the exception of about 3 speeches one of which was never recorded) ALL of the keynotes from 1997-2006. But it got shut down by apple legal after it gained some publicity. Then up until about a week ago there was a web site called ExpoWiki.org, created by two of the applekeynotes.com team, until they ran into bandwidth trouble and now that ones down too.
